Figure 2: Effect of electron irradiation on the superconducting transition in BaFe2(As1−xPx)2 single crystals.
From: Disorder-induced topological change of the superconducting gap structure in iron pnictides

(a) Temperature dependence of the TDO frequency shift normalized by the total shift during the superconducting transitions for crystals (#28A and #28B) from a batch of Tc0=28 K with irradiated doses of 0, 1.0, 2.0, 4.0 and 6.0 C cm−2 with decreasing Tc. (b) Similar plot for crystals (#29A, #29B, #29C, #29D and #29E) from a batch of Tc0=29 K with irradiated doses of 0, 1.5, 2.7, 4.7, 4.9 and 8.3 C cm−2 with decreasing Tc. (c) Temperature dependence of resistivity for a crystal (#30A) with Tc0=30 K with irradiated doses of 0, 1.1, 2.3, 3.8 and 4.5 C cm−2 with decreasing Tc. Dotted lines are linear extrapolations to zero temperature to estimate changes in residual resistivity Δρ0. (d) Transition temperature Tc normalized by the pristine value Tc0=30 K as a function of Δρ0, determined by the resistivity measurements in crystal #30A.
